    Abstract

    Unlike other sealing devices which are internal to a bag and adhered to the bag by heat or glue the current invention is external to the bag, is not adhered to the bag by heat or glue, is free to be moved up or down the bag to remove excess air, is reusable, and can be used on one type of a bag in one instant, removed, and be used on another type of bag. Furthermore, on current sealing devices if anything comes in-between the male and female seals which go directly into each other it renders the seal ineffective, but the current invention is not disturbed at all, and in fact the bag type container becomes part of the seal.

    Claims

    1. A seal for securing a bag type container in-between the seal comprising: a) A flexible longitudinal seal with an orthogonal male portion that goes from narrow to wide one or more times in the direction of its outer limit that extends across the entire length of the seal which is one part of the seal; and b) a bag type container which becomes a part of the seal in-between the male and female portion of the seal; and c) a flexible longitudinal seal with a female portion that goes from narrow to wide one or more times in the direction of the inside of the seal that extends across the entire length of the seal which is the other part of the seal and has the means to secure a bag type container that is shaped in such a manner where the female side of the seal has a portion which grabs the bag type container and the matching male portion of the seal at its narrowest point.
